Treatment Goals:

Each patient has goal they wish to attain. My goal as a healthcare provider is to help you get there safely.  

Common goals for the MTF:

Decreased facial/body hair 

Increased breast size/breast growth 

Change in body fat distribution 

Weight loss/weight gain 

Softening of facial skin and other features 

Decreased or elimination of erection/ejaculation 

Maintain a strong transgender identity 

Maintain a strong feminine identity 

Change in voice tone or quality 

Decreased or reverse male pattern baldness 

Vaginoplasty and/or other surgeries 

No surgery 

Common goals for the FTM: 

Facial hair with or without body hair 

Increased body musculature 

Maintain a strong transgender identity 

Maintain a strong male identity 

Mastectomy Phalloplasty 

No surgery 

Masculine body

Our goals are:

To Increased your overall health and well-being; 

To increase your  trust and ability to overcome previous negative experiences in medical systems;

To ensure your adherence to advice regarding lab tests, office visits etc;

To discuss avenues of harm reduction regarding substance use, sexual practices, occupational sex work; 

To discuss your HIV risk and testing options;

To offer comprehensive primary care; and,

To serve as a link between the you and social, medical, psychological and educational opportunities available.
